What makes discs fly the way they do? by smitty17 in discgolf

[–]jayson88 4 points5 points  (0 children)

Here's a great video that explains it very well at the 4:30 mark: http://youtu.be/8IT7aABWEKw

Basically it's a gyroscopic effect from the weight of the rim. The high speed out your hand keeps the weight to the right, as it slows down the weight transfers to the left.
